eZ Publish Community Project (Legacy Stack) 2013.4
Class

eZCodePage

class eZCodePage

Constants

CACHE_CODE_DATE

Properties

$RequestedCharsetCode
$CharsetCode
$CharsetEncodingScheme
$UnicodeMap
$UTF8Map
$CodeMap
$UTF8CodeMap
$MinCharValue
$MaxCharValue
$Valid
$SubstituteChar

Methods

eZCodePage($charset_code, $use_cache = true)

convertString($str)

convertStringToUnicode($str)

convertUnicodeToString($unicodeValues)

convertStringFromUTF8($multi_char)

strlen($str)

strlenFromUTF8($str)

charToUtf8($str, $pos, $charLen)

charToUnicode($str, $pos, $charLen)

codeToUtf8($code)

codeToUnicode($code)

utf8ToChar($ucode)

unicodeToChar($ucode)

utf8ToCode($ucode)

unicodeToCode($ucode)

substituteChar()

setSubstituteChar($char)

cacheFileName($charset_code)

fileModification($charset_code)

codepageList()

storeCacheObject($filename, $permissionArray)

cacheFilepath()

load($use_cache = true)

charsetCode()

requestedCharsetCode()

minCharValue()

maxCharValue()

isValid()

Details

at line 25
public eZCodePage($charset_code, $use_cache = true)

Parameters

$charset_code
$use_cache

at line 38
public convertString($str)

Parameters

$str

at line 56
public convertStringToUnicode($str)

Parameters

$str

at line 71
public convertUnicodeToString($unicodeValues)

Parameters

$unicodeValues

at line 84
public convertStringFromUTF8($multi_char)

Parameters

$multi_char

at line 207
public strlen($str)

Parameters

$str

at line 228
public strlenFromUTF8($str)

Parameters

$str

at line 233
public charToUtf8($str, $pos, $charLen)

Parameters

$str
$pos
$charLen

at line 247
public charToUnicode($str, $pos, $charLen)

Parameters

$str
$pos
$charLen

at line 261
public codeToUtf8($code)

Parameters

$code

at line 266
public codeToUnicode($code)

Parameters

$code

at line 275
public utf8ToChar($ucode)

Parameters

$ucode

at line 289
public unicodeToChar($ucode)

Parameters

$ucode

at line 303
public utf8ToCode($ucode)

Parameters

$ucode

at line 310
public unicodeToCode($ucode)

Parameters

$ucode

at line 317
public substituteChar()

at line 322
public setSubstituteChar($char)

Parameters

$char

at line 348
public cacheFileName($charset_code)

Parameters

$charset_code

at line 361
public fileModification($charset_code)

Parameters

$charset_code

at line 369
public codepageList()

at line 392
public storeCacheObject($filename, $permissionArray)

Parameters

$filename
$permissionArray

at line 482
public cacheFilepath()

at line 502
public load($use_cache = true)

Parameters

$use_cache

at line 664
public charsetCode()

at line 672
public requestedCharsetCode()

at line 680
public minCharValue()

at line 688
public maxCharValue()

at line 696
public isValid()